7 you shall certainly let the mother go, but the young you may take for yourself, (A)in order that it may be well with you and that you may prolong your days.
8 “When you build a new house, you shall make a parapet for your roof, so that you will not bring bloodguilt on your house if anyone falls from it.
9 “(B)You shall not sow your vineyard with two kinds of seed, or [a]all the produce of the seed which you have sown and the increase of the vineyard will become defiled.
